The detection of circuit cuts

Ghost immobilisers are among the most effective security for cars devices available. These devices offer a high level of protection from key theft and hacking of vehicles. They work by integrating into a vehicle's CAN data network.

The CAN bus is a small data network that runs throughout your vehicle. It is almost impossible to detect and professional thieves will require specialized tools to bypass it. However criminals have adapted to the latest technology and are now employing relay attacks to evade car security devices.

As opposed to other immobilisers Ghost does not transmit radio or light signals. This means it can be concealed and put in place without markings on the interior of the vehicle. This permits it to be used on new and used vehicles.

This is the reason Ghost has a slim chance of being detected. It does not use any signals or radios to communicate with the vehicle's ECU unit. It is simple to install. Instead of cutting and run wires to connect it, it utilizes the original buttons to work.

The Ghost can not only deter key theft, but it will also lower your insurance cost. A ghost immobiliser will make sure that you aren't able to drive your car without it. To allow authorized drivers to unlock your car you can also change the PIN code.

The Ghost immobiliser also stops the vehicle's ECU being compromised. By having a Ghost immobiliser in place it is extremely difficult to copy the key. Ghost doesn't require a key fob in order to start the engine.

The Ghost can also be programmed to allow access to its location. This can be done using a pin pad. It is a combination button in the driver's seat. The pin pad is programmable and can be programmed to enable the car to begin, or exit service mode based on time.

Ghost is a great solution to the growing threat of modern theft methods. You should consider adding a Ghost immobiliser if you own an CANBus vehicle.

Ghost car security systems communicate with the vehicle's ECU using a CAN databus. This allows the device to be mounted almost anywhere on the vehicle. This makes the system extremely low-risk in the event of installing.

The Autowatch Ghost Immobiliser generates a unique PIN code which is used to lock your vehicle when it starts. You can then type the code into the buttons on the dashboard or steering wheel.
